If you want to experience how things are done in the Finance & Corporate Actuarial team at our Hong Kong Branch, join us on a permanent, full-time basis commencing at the earliest possible date as an Actuarial Analyst.

 

You can look forward to

  • Performing valuation processes for Solvency or IFRS reporting, in accordance with established methodologies, assumptions, and internal guidelines.
  • Analyzing and interpreting results to provide clear, meaningful insights for various stakeholders, investigating anomalies, trends, or inconsistencies as needed
  • Supporting the review and setting of actuarial assumptions, including review of experience analysis and contributing to assumption governance processes and enhancing actuarial models.
  • Reviewing and validating data from cedants to ensure compliance with contract terms; resolve discrepancies or unusual patterns.
  • Collaborating with internal teams—including accounting, underwriting, and fellow actuaries—to ensure data integrity and accuracy across core databases.
  • Proposing and executing improvements to actuarial processes, reporting tools, and documentation standards
  • Handling ad hoc requests and/or other actuarial/database projects as required

You come equipped with

  • Degree holder in Actuarial Science, Mathematics, Statistics, Computer Science, or a related discipline
  • Around 3 years of relevant actuarial experience preferred; less experienced candidates might be considered.
  • Progress in actuarial examinations with a recognized professional body (e.g. SOA, IFoA, CAS) is an advantage
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Excel and SQL; knowledge of other programming languages (e.g. Python, R) is a plus
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ving and organizational skills with high attention to detail
  • Good interpersonal skills, a collaborative mindset, and a proactive attitude
  • Execellent command of spoken and written English and Chinese as the role requires liaising with internal and external stakeholders.
